Abstract

A major limitation of the lithium-bromide-water system in chilling systems is its low salt solubility, which prevents the strong solution from the generator from being cooled to nearer the absorber temperature without salt crystallization. Such salt crystallization could cause blockages in the solution circuits and result in loss of efficiency. Zinc bromide was tested with acqueous solutions of lithium bromide within a solution temperature range of 25–80°C. Zinc bromide was found to improvel significantly the solubility of lithium bromide in water.
